As a Security Professional Armed Patrol Government Licensed in Los Angeles, CA, you will serve and safeguard clients in a range of industries such as Government, and more.
Join Allied Universal as a Patrol Armed Officer, where you will actively monitor and patrol government locations to help deter security-related incidents and provide peace of mind to those you serve. This position requires both armed and driving responsibilities, allowing you to respond quickly and appropriately to situations as they arise. You will be a visible presence, offering exceptional customer service and communication while upholding our values of teamwork, integrity, and a people-first approach. Be part of a dynamic team dedicated to creating a secure environment through innovation and reliability.
Position Type: Full Time
Pay Rate: $28.00 / Hour
